The Claim

Genetically determined higher post-challenge insulin secretion is positively correlated with body mass index (BMI), and this correlation suggests a causal role for insulin in promoting adiposity independent of diet or behavior.

Source: Why hyperinsulinemia is detrimental to weight loss: insights from type 1 diabetes

Why this might work

When insulin levels rise after eating, it tells fat cells to stop breaking down stored fat and start making new fat from sugar. This effect lasts for days, even after insulin levels drop, so fat keeps accumulating instead of being burned for energy.
